Our Purpose

At BAE Systems we serve, supply and protect those who serve and protect us,

in a corporate culture that is performance driven and values led.

We have an important role in society because we:

Help our customers to provide security

Contribute to the economic prosperity of the places where our people live and work

Support high value jobs and employee rights

Value our people and their diversity

Develop cutting-edge technologies

Provide best-in-class products and services by forging strong relationships with our suppliers and partners

Support local communities

Inspire in the work we do

Identify opportunities for individuals from disadvantaged backgrounds

Will reduce the environmental impact of our activities
